Classic Vocal Prot House From 1982 - Remastered & re-issued - Another West-End sure-shot! This sublime piece of early electronic Boogie has always worn it's "classic" badge with a relaxed sense of pride since it's release in 1982, perhaps it's the languid synthed out groove supplied by studio maestros Nick martinelli & David Todd or Brenda Taylor's sublime vocals reminding us all that the game of love is always a 2 way street that are to blame

Whatever it is, this is a solid, classic slice of Disco gold, more on the down to mid-tempo tip but still big enough to keep the dance-floors packed from the Garage to the Loft & beyond with ease! The production simply sounds years ahead of it's time (still does!) & it has the FUNK in bucket-loads, this is as essential as it gets, the real deal. Featured here are all the original mixes that were on the 1982 pressing (Yes! There's a dub mix!).

Re-mastered, re-pressed & re-released for 2015 with all original West End Records label artwork intact. Done in conjunction & with the permission of all right holders.
